dnn(IE): use HAVE_DNN_IE_NN_BUILDER_2019 for NN Builder API code
authorAlexander Alekhin <alexander.a.alekhin@gmail.com>
Tue, 3 Mar 2020 08:01:44 +0000 (08:01 +0000)
committerAlexander Alekhin <alexander.a.alekhin@gmail.com>
Tue, 3 Mar 2020 08:07:54 +0000 (08:07 +0000)
commit124bf8339f4cd56a53593e384f572cf837143b87
tree619494964cebacf769d109baf545b13236737136
parent4d0f13544db8ea0fd1e439992a7ffd215ce15114
dnn(IE): use HAVE_DNN_IE_NN_BUILDER_2019 for NN Builder API code

- CMake option: OPENCV_DNN_IE_NN_BUILDER_2019
32 files changed:
modules/dnn/CMakeLists.txt
modules/dnn/src/dnn.cpp
modules/dnn/src/ie_ngraph.cpp
modules/dnn/src/layers/batch_norm_layer.cpp
modules/dnn/src/layers/blank_layer.cpp
modules/dnn/src/layers/concat_layer.cpp
modules/dnn/src/layers/const_layer.cpp
modules/dnn/src/layers/convolution_layer.cpp
modules/dnn/src/layers/detection_output_layer.cpp
modules/dnn/src/layers/elementwise_layers.cpp
modules/dnn/src/layers/eltwise_layer.cpp
modules/dnn/src/layers/flatten_layer.cpp
modules/dnn/src/layers/fully_connected_layer.cpp
modules/dnn/src/layers/lrn_layer.cpp
modules/dnn/src/layers/mvn_layer.cpp
modules/dnn/src/layers/normalize_bbox_layer.cpp
modules/dnn/src/layers/padding_layer.cpp
modules/dnn/src/layers/permute_layer.cpp
modules/dnn/src/layers/pooling_layer.cpp
modules/dnn/src/layers/prior_box_layer.cpp
modules/dnn/src/layers/proposal_layer.cpp
modules/dnn/src/layers/reorg_layer.cpp
modules/dnn/src/layers/reshape_layer.cpp
modules/dnn/src/layers/resize_layer.cpp
modules/dnn/src/layers/scale_layer.cpp
modules/dnn/src/layers/slice_layer.cpp
modules/dnn/src/layers/softmax_layer.cpp
modules/dnn/src/op_inf_engine.cpp
modules/dnn/src/op_inf_engine.hpp
modules/dnn/test/test_common.impl.hpp
modules/dnn/test/test_misc.cpp
modules/ts/src/ts_tags.cpp